你查询的IP:[119.78.210.123]  地理位置:中国科技网

最新查询218.240.71.193 120.251.209.66 119.19.158.231 118.239.35.185 218.96.216.192 123.196.13.221 117.48.186.177 218.192.190.13 218.96.145.132 119.78.210.123 123.112.146.35 124.160.178.207 210.14.64.237 125.214.96.237 220.192.96.199 61.48.75.79 117.60.112.96 202.91.128.6 220.248.138.149 117.106.54.15 202.38.158.58 202.96.21.233 219.224.81.68 116.213.64.216 121.16.122.32 124.243.192.118 202.60.112.136 119.248.51.217 203.18.50.33 202.165.96.88 119.62.74.99